WITH a huge foreign debt, the government of President Ferdinand “Bongbong” R. Marcos Jr. needs to boost its revenues to be able to meet the needs of the mushrooming population.

As the country’s legislative arm, Congress, which is composed of the Senate and the House of Representatives, is supposed to be the first rampart of democracy in this part of the world.

Of course, the people are made to believe that our 24 senators and more than 300 district/sectoral congressmen are in a position to meet the needs and aspirations of the 110 million Filipinos.

Thus, the two-chamber Congress would do well to fast-track the passage of a piece of legislation, which is aimed at boosting government revenues.

Initially, the crusading Marcos Jr. administration, which ends at 12 high noon on June 30, 2028, wants to tax all digital or online transactions and single-use plastic products.

The proposed two tax measures are expected to generate an estimated yearly value-added tax (VAT) collection of more than P14.2 billion, according to Finance Secretary Benjamin Diokno.

Diokno said: “If you buy a product from a regular store, you pay tax; I think we should also pay tax on online sales,” said Diokno, who used to be the governor of the Central Bank of the Philippines.

Aside from boosting government revenues, the planned tax on single-use plastic products is seen to be a big help to the success of the national government’s campaign to address climate change.

Admittedly, single-use plastic products thrown by informal settlers or squatters and passersby into stinking drainage canals, esteros, rivers and lakes clog these waterways.

As a result, these waterways easily overflow their banks,sending rampaging floodwaters to low-lying communities not only in Metropolitan Manila (MM) but elsewhere.
